    The Sospan, and Royal Ship in Dolgellau are both good, as is the steak house alongside the main car park. If you want to travel a little further to Barmouth, The Last Inn is really nice, but usually needs booking in advance, and if you want a good chippy, The Mermaid, across the road from the railway station does excellent fish & chips (but don’t feed the seagulls, there’s a massive fine if you get nabbed for it).

    Yep, echoing the above, Dol is nice. Barmouth has a few pubs (Last Inn is characterful, Bistro Bermo is nice and a bit more upmarket, the curry house Saffron is really good).

    The George is spectacularly located right on the estuary, but it’s a Robinsons’ pub so you get standard (OK>good) pub fayre and you’d better like their beer because they don’t sell any local ale. That’s generally a deal-breaker for me but the pub is in such a good location it’s worth it.
